Why Goals Matter on Social Media
Defining your goals is the foundation of any successful social media strategy. It’s not just about posting consistently; it’s about making sure your efforts drive meaningful results. Here’s why it’s important:
- Focus and Direction
Goals provide clarity and ensure your content and campaigns work toward achieving something tangible, like increased sales or greater engagement. - Aligning with Business Needs
Social media objectives should connect to your business priorities. For example, if your business goal is to increase online sales, your social media goal might focus on driving more website traffic. - Tracking Progress
Clear goals make it easier to measure success and refine your approach over time.
SMART Goals: A Framework for Success
A structured approach to setting goals is critical. The SMART framework—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ound—is a tried-and-true method for creating objectives you can realistically achieve.

- Specific: Focus on a particular outcome.
- Example: “Increase Instagram followers by 15%.”
- Measurable: Define metrics to track progress.
- Example: “Grow followers from 1,000 to 1,150.”
- Achievable: Set goals that are realistic given your resources.
- Example: “Post three engaging Reels weekly to achieve growth.”
- Relevant: Tie goals to your overall business priorities.
- Example: “Expand Instagram reach to raise awareness for a product launch.”
- Time-bound: Set a clear deadline.
- Example: “Reach this target by March 2025.”
Examples of Effective Social Media Objectives
Need inspiration for your own goals? Here are a few examples that demonstrate how clear objectives can support your business strategy:
- Build Brand Awareness
- Goal: Increase Instagram followers by 15% by March 2025.
- Plan: Create and share Reels that showcase your products and collaborate with influencers.
- Generate Website Traffic
- Goal: Boost website visits from social media by 25% in Q1 2025.
- Plan: Use Facebook posts and Instagram Stories to link back to your blog.
- Increase Sales
- Goal: Generate 50 new leads monthly via Facebook Ads by June 2025.
- Plan: Launch a lead-generation campaign with a free downloadable resource.
Turning Goals Into Action
Once you’ve set your objectives, the next step is to build a plan for achieving them. Start by auditing your current performance, identifying areas for improvement, and deciding on the metrics you’ll track to measure success. Breaking larger goals into smaller, actionable steps can also make the process less overwhelming.
